slides load very slow after publish
Jun 19, 2013
I have made a project with a few slides containing a drag and drop excercise. It's not big yet, it's only a start, but I wanted to show it to our customer already to hear his feedback. So I published the course to try it. On my desktop, where I develop, it works good, but when I move it to the network and try with a company pc, then it goes very slow... On the 3th slide (after the menu) there are 5 objects, clicking on the objects shows different layers. When the page is loaded and I start clicking, nothing happens. I have to wait for a while (half a minute, a minute, ...) and after that it works.... The same with the following slides, every time I have to wait a while until it works...
What can be the reason?? There are not many slides, so that can't be the problem... Some slides have a lot of triggers, maybe that's the reason?? But that's the great thing about storyline, so it shouldn't be a problem...
I did notice that storyline generates a lot of .swf files, a lot more than other courses I did before, maybe that's the reason? But what can I do to avoid this??

Hi Katja!
The one thing you mentioned that caught my attention as a possible problem is that you're sharing the file on your "network". Do you mean you're trying to launch the published output files on a network drive? If so, that may be what's causing the delay.
